GCSE: BUDDING mathematicians Cameron Husselbury, Zaynab Khalid and Daanyaal Hussain are flying high after achieving a GCSE at 11-years-old.
The trio, along with Kieran O’Reilly (who was on holiday when the results came out) attend Hey With Zion Primary in Lees and were handpicked to do the exam five years early.
Teacher Andrew Clowes said: “I am delighted for the children that they have achieved such success. They have enjoyed the challenge all the way through and they love maths.”
